The Importance of Sustainable Tourism in New Hampshire

New Hampshire's economy heavily relies on tourism, with visitors contributing approximately $4.2 billion in spending annually. However, increased visitor numbers can strain local resources and impact environmental integrity. Given the state's natural beauty and diverse landscapes, sustainable tourism development has emerged as a vital focus for preserving New Hampshire's cultural and environmental heritage.

Who Benefits From Sustainable Tourism Initiatives?

Tourism in New Hampshire not only serves the state’s economy but also supports local communities. Many New Hampshire residents depend on the seasonal influx of visitors for their livelihoods, particularly in rural areas where traditional job opportunities may be limited. However, balancing tourist activity with environmental conservation is crucial to ensure that both residents and visitors can enjoy the state's resources for generations to come.

Moreover, sustainable tourism initiatives provide opportunities for local businesses to engage with visitors more responsibly. By promoting eco-friendly practices and responsible visitor engagement, tourism operators can enhance their offerings and attract a conscientious customer base that values sustainability.

Funding for Sustainable Tourism Development

This grant program, which offers up to $10,000, is designed to support sustainable tourism initiatives in New Hampshire. Funding will be allocated to projects that focus on eco-friendly business practices and programs that encourage responsible visitor engagement. Local businesses, nonprofit organizations, and community groups are encouraged to apply for funding to develop and implement sustainability workshops and resources.
